2. Difficulties Of Reusing Solar Panels
It is widely approved that recycling solar panels has lots of ecological advantages, however, it is additionally true that the process isn't without its obstacles. Yet exactly what are these obstacles? Allow's explore better.
Among the most significant problems with recycling photovoltaic panels is the intricacy of the job itself. It can be hard to break down the different elements, such as glass and steel, to be reused individually. Furthermore, solar panel suppliers frequently have a mix of materials used in their items that makes sorting them even more complicated. Additionally, there are safety and security and health and wellness dangers entailed with handling broken glass or breathing in fumes from melting components.
Another crucial challenge associated with reusing solar panels is cost. Several countries do not have adequate infrastructure or resources to sufficiently reuse these items which results in greater costs for organizations attempting to do so. Furthermore, solar energy systems for homes to the customized nature of reusing photovoltaic panels, this can produce a financial burden on firms trying to remain compliant with regulations. Ultimately, these costs could be passed down to consumers making it hard for them to afford renewable resource resources.

3. Approaches For Recycling Solar Panels
As the globe pursues an extra sustainable future, reusing solar panels is an increasingly popular job. Amidst this expanding interest, nonetheless, we have to think about the approaches that are in location to make it feasible.
To begin with, numerous companies have carried out a 'take-back' system wherein old or damaged photovoltaic panels can be accumulated and sent out to their particular factories for reusing. In this manner, the materials have the ability to be reused in the building and construction of new items. Furthermore, some communities have actually also started using rewards for individuals desiring to recycle their photovoltaic panels; this could range from tax breaks to cost-free delivery expenses.
Furthermore, modern technology has come to be increasingly innovative when it involves reusing solar panels-- with specialised machines efficient in separating out all the various elements within them. For example, by utilizing AI-powered robot arms, these machines can draw out useful materials such as copper and aluminium while likewise throwing away hazardous waste securely. Therefore, this process is both time and cost effective-- allowing us to make better use of our resources whilst keeping our environment clean.
